Navigating the sometimes murky waters of SEO requires the precision of a captain, especially when it comes to pointing search engines in the right direction. In 2026, with Google and other search engine algorithms becoming incredibly sophisticated, the technical management of websites leaves no room for guesswork. Often overlooked by newcomers to semantic markup, the canonical tag plays a crucial role in the modern SEO arsenal. It acts like a beacon, signaling to search engine crawlers the original and legitimate version of content among a multitude of similar pages. Mastering this tool is essential to avoid diluting your authority and ensuring your site stays afloat in search results.
- In short: The canonical tag indicates the original URL that search engines should prioritize.
- It is the ultimate weapon against duplicate content.
- Its use is crucial for e-commerce sites that generate multiple URL variations. By 2026, it helps structure data for AI-generated responses.
- Poor implementation can unintentionally deindex strategic pages.
Definition and Functioning of the Canonical Tag in SEO
The canonical tag, technically designated by the attribute `rel=”canonical”`, is a piece of HTML code located in the header (the “ section) of a web page. Its primary function is to indicate to search engine crawlers, such as those of Google or Bing, which is the main version of a page when there are multiple URLs offering identical or very similar content. It is an essential standardization guideline in today’s web ecosystem. To understand its usefulness, imagine you're displaying the same fish at three different stalls in a market. If you don't tell customers (search engines) which stall is the main one, they'll be confused and won't know where to buy. The canonical tag solves this dilemma by pointing to the reference stall. A canonical tag always contains a URL. This can be the URL of the page itself: in this case, the page is said to self-designate itself as the page to be indexed. This is a standard and recommended practice to protect your original content. Conversely, the tag can contain a different URL. In this configuration, the visited page asks search engines not to prioritize it and designates another page to be indexed instead. The principle is simple: if the canonical tag points to the page itself, the content is indexed. If it points to another page, the SEO "juice" and authority are transferred to this canonical target. This is a vital authority-building mechanism forunderstanding the secrets of the code
and optimizing how bots crawl your site.
The crucial importance of managing duplicate content Duplicate content is the sworn enemy of a healthy SEO strategy. When search engines encounter multiple versions of the same information accessible via different URLs, they struggle to determine which one to include in their index and which one to rank for a given query. This confusion often leads to a dilution of page popularity, dividing the power of your backlinks among several variations instead of concentrating it on a single strong URL.
If Google detects duplicate content on your site without clear indication, you risk algorithmic devaluation. This doesn’t always mean a manual penalty, but rather a loss of effectiveness: your pages cannibalize each other, and none reach the top position. The purpose of the canonical tag in SEO is therefore to prevent this disastrous scenario. It allows you to effectively resolve duplicate content issues while improving your pages’ indexing by search engines.
It’s essential to understand that duplication isn’t always the result of external content theft. It’s often technical and internal: HTTP vs. HTTPS versions, URLs with or without “www,” or even tracking parameters added to the end of links. Without the canonical tag, these technical variations generate thousands of “ghost pages” in Google’s eyes.
E-commerce sites are at the forefront of the need for rigorous management of canonical URLs. The very structure of a product catalog naturally generates duplicates. Take the example of search filters and sorting. When a user sorts products by price or filters by color, the URL often changes to include parameters (for example:
?sort=price_asc or ?color=blue ), but the displayed content remains substantially the same as the main category page. Product page derivatives represent another classic challenge. Imagine an initial product page accessible viahttps://www.site.com/product-x
. If a user selects size “S”, the URL might become https://www.site.com/product-x?size=sFrom the search engine’s perspective, these are two distinct pages with identical content. This is where the canonical tag becomes crucial. The variant with the size parameter must have a canonical tag pointing to the product’s own URL (without the parameter). This clearly indicates that the original page is the authoritative one. Warning:
Failing to manage these navigation facets is a major technical error that can waste your crawl budget (the time Google allocates to visiting your site). If the crawler spends its time visiting sorting variants, it may not discover your new product pages. For a site health check, analyzing these tags on faceted pages is a priority. A/B Testing and Content Syndication Beyond e-commerce, the canonical tag is a valuable tool for marketing teams conducting A/B tests. Let’s say you have a high-performing blog post and you want to test a new design or layout to increase conversions. You’re going to create a duplicate version of this article. To compare performance, half the traffic will be directed to version A and the other half to version B. Without precautions, Google would see two identical articles and could penalize this duplication. The solution is simple: the canonical tag of the duplicate article (version B) must redirect to the original article (version A). This way, Google won’t be confused. It understands that this is a test and continues to attribute all SEO authority to the original version, while allowing you to analyze user behavior on the variant.Content syndication is another common scenario. If you publish your articles on other platforms (like Medium or LinkedIn) or if partners republish your content, it’s vital to ensure a canonical tag points to your source article on your own domain. This guarantees that your site remains the original source in the eyes of search engines, protecting you against the risk of a third-party site ranking higher than you for your own content. Canonical, 301, or NoIndex?
The interactive decision tree for your SEO in 2026
SEO Decision Support Tool • 2026 Mode
${step.title}
${step.desc}
Snippet to insert in the or .htaccess
${step.code.replace(//g, ‘>’)}
`;
} else {
// Rendering the QUESTION
`;
Vous avez un projet spécifique ?
Kevin Grillot accompagne entrepreneurs et PME en SEO, webmarketing et stratégie digitale. Bénéficiez d'un audit ou d'un accompagnement sur-mesure.
// Initialization
renderStep(‘start’); })(); Technical Implementation: Code and Best Practices 2026
Let’s move on to the server room. How do we actually add this tag? The syntax is standardized and must be followed precisely. An incorrect canonical tag can do more harm than the absence of one. The code must be inserted between the “ and “ tags of your HTML document.
Here is the exact structure to use: “ It is imperative to use absolute URLs (including `https://www.`) rather than relative URLs (like `/main-page/`).By 2026, the use of HTTPS is the undisputed standard; ensure that your canonical tags point to the secure version of your site. A common mistake is pointing to the HTTP version, which creates a technical inconsistency. Depending on the CMS used, insertion can be automated. On platforms like WordPress, SEO plugins handle this natively. By default, they often configure a self-referential tag (the page points to itself), which is a good starting point. However, for advanced configurations, manual intervention or fine-tuning is necessary. For those who want to optimize their site globally, checking the generated source code is an essential validation step.Canonical vs. 301 Redirect: Don’t Confuse the Signals
Confusion often exists between the canonical tag and the 301 redirect. Although both address duplicate URL or outdated URL issues, their functions are radically different and should not be used interchangeably. It’s crucial to grasp this nuance to properly manage your SEO strategy. A 301 redirect is a server-side directive that forces both the user’s browser and the search engine crawler to go to a new URL. The old page is no longer visually accessible; it’s replaced. This is the preferred method when you delete a page, change your site’s structure, or permanently migrate content.Conversely, the canonical tag is a “soft” approach. Both pages (the duplicate and the original) remain accessible to visitors. You use the canonical tag when you want the user to be able to see the page (for example, a product page with a price filter enabled), but you want Google to ignore this version for indexing. Using a 301 redirect on filter facets would make navigation impossible for the user. Understanding this distinction is one of the advanced technical aspects that a good website manager must master.
Criteria
Canonical Tag
301 Redirect Accessibility Both pages remain visible to the user.
| The user is automatically redirected to the new page. | Signal to Search Engines | “Index this other page, but keep this one accessible.” |
|---|---|---|
| “This page has moved permanently, forget the old one.” | Transfer of SEO Authority | |
| Yes, the majority of the authority is transferred. | Yes, almost all of the authority is transferred. Typical Use Cases | Similar products, sorting, filtering, A/B testing. |
| Site migration, page deletion, URL changes. | Pitfalls to Avoid and Tag Auditing | Even with the best intentions, it’s easy to make mistakes when implementing canonical tags. One of the most common errors is canonical chaining. This occurs when page A has a canonical link to page B, and page B has a canonical link to page C. Search engine crawlers hate this kind of chaining and may end up ignoring all your directives. |
| Another critical error is placing a canonical tag on a page while simultaneously blocking that same page via the robots.txt file or a noindex tag. | If you tell Google “This is the official version” (canonical) but also “Don’t crawl this page” (robots.txt), you’re sending conflicting signals. The result is often unpredictable and detrimental to your visibility. Complete consistency between your indexing directives is essential. |
To ensure everything is in order, it’s necessary to
perform regular technical audits.
Tools like Google Search Console (in the “Pages” section) will alert you if Google has chosen a canonical URL different from the one you declared. This generally indicates that your signal wasn’t clear enough or that the algorithm considers the quality of the designated page insufficient. https://www.youtube.com/watch?v=xG7Hc2f-3U0 The Canonical Tag in the Age of AI and SGEIn 2026, the massive arrival of Search Generative Experience (SGE) and AI-powered answer engines further reinforces the importance of data structuring. AI seeks reliable and clear sources to build its answers. A clean URL structure, guided by precise canonical tags, makes it easier for these new models to understand your site.
Technical clarity has become a criterion for trust. A site with multiple duplicates and no canonical tag management appears “messy” and less trustworthy as a source for an AI-generated answer. Technical optimization is no longer just about ranking in a list of blue links, but a prerequisite for appearing in conversational answers. Furthermore, with mobile-first indexing now the absolute standard, ensure your canonical tags are correctly implemented on the mobile versions of your sites, especially if you’re still using separate mobile site configurations (m.site.com), even though responsive design is the norm. Consistency between the desktop and mobile versions is closely monitored. Is the canonical tag mandatory on all pages?
Can I use a cross-domain canonical tag?
Absolutely. You can place a canonical tag on site A that points to site B. This is very useful for content syndication, when you publish the same article on multiple different websites, to give all the SEO credit to the original site. How long does it take for Google to index a canonical tag?
It depends on how often your site is crawled. It can take anywhere from a few days to several weeks. Google needs to revisit the page, read the tag, and update its index. You can speed up the process using the URL Inspection tool in Search Console.
What happens if Google ignores my canonical tag?
{“@context”:”https://schema.org”,”@type”:”FAQPage”,”mainEntity”:[{“@type”:”Question”,”name”:”La balise canonical est-elle obligatoire sur toutes les pages ?”,”acceptedAnswer”:{“@type”:”Answer”,”text”:”Idu00e9alement, oui. Chaque page devrait avoir une balise canonical. Si c’est une page unique, elle doit avoir une balise auto-ru00e9fu00e9rente (pointant vers elle-mu00eame). Cela protu00e8ge votre contenu contre le vol (scraping) en indiquant que vous u00eates la source originale.”}},{“@type”:”Question”,”name”:”Puis-je utiliser une balise canonical cross-domain ?”,”acceptedAnswer”:{“@type”:”Answer”,”text”:”Absolument. Vous pouvez placer une balise canonical sur un site A qui pointe vers un site B. C’est tru00e8s utile pour la syndication de contenu, lorsque vous publiez le mu00eame article sur plusieurs sites web diffu00e9rents, pour donner tout le cru00e9dit SEO au site original.”}},{“@type”:”Question”,”name”:”Combien de temps faut-il u00e0 Google pour prendre en compte une canonical ?”,”acceptedAnswer”:{“@type”:”Answer”,”text”:”Cela du00e9pend de la fru00e9quence de crawl de votre site. Cela peut prendre de quelques jours u00e0 plusieurs semaines. Google doit repasser sur la page, lire la balise et mettre u00e0 jour son index. Vous pouvez accu00e9lu00e9rer le processus via l’outil d’inspection d’URL de la Search Console.”}},{“@type”:”Question”,”name”:”Que se passe-t-il si Google ignore ma balise canonical ?”,”acceptedAnswer”:{“@type”:”Answer”,”text”:”Si Google ignore votre balise, c’est souvent parce qu’il estime que la page canonique du00e9claru00e9e n’est pas assez pertinente ou qualitative par rapport u00e0 la page dupliquu00e9e. Il choisira alors sa propre URL canonique. Vu00e9rifiez la qualitu00e9 du contenu et la cohu00e9rence des signaux internes (liens).”}}]}If Google ignores your tag, it’s often because it considers the declared canonical page not relevant or of sufficient quality compared to the duplicate page. It will then choose its own canonical URL. Check the quality of your content and the consistency of your internal signals (links).
📋 Checklist SEO gratuite — 50 points à vérifier
Téléchargez ma checklist SEO complète : technique, contenu, netlinking. Le même outil que j'utilise pour mes clients.
Télécharger la checklistBesoin de visibilité pour votre activité ?
Je suis Kevin Grillot, consultant SEO freelance certifié. J'accompagne les TPE et PME en référencement naturel, Google Ads, Meta Ads et création de site internet.
Checklist SEO Local gratuite — 15 points à vérifier
Téléchargez notre checklist et vérifiez si votre site est optimisé pour Google.
- 15 points essentiels pour le SEO local
- Format actionnable et imprimable
- Utilisé par +200 entrepreneurs